Bayshore Boulevard: Tampa's Crown Jewel



Bayshore Boulevard deserves its online reputation as one of America's a lot of beautiful constant pathways, however the roadway itself offers an equally remarkable experience. This 4.5-mile stretch leaves Hillsborough Bay, connecting downtown Tampa with the historical Hyde Park area. The drive treats you to unhampered water sights on one side and classy historical homes shaded by large oak trees on the various other.



Starting from downtown, the blvd curves delicately along the natural contours of the bay. October's comfy temperatures mean you can roll down the windows and capture the salt-tinged wind rolling off the water. Sailboats dot the bay, and if you time your drive right around sunup, you'll witness the sky changing from deep purple to brilliant orange as the sun climbs up over the city skyline behind you.



The southerly end of Bayshore opens near Ballast Point Park, where the bay expands and you can see clear throughout to the Interbay Peninsula. This section of the drive uses a few of the very best views, particularly during the golden hour prior to sundown when the light turns everything cozy and radiant. The Courtney Campbell Causeway Experience



Linking Tampa to Clearwater, the Courtney Campbell Causeway extends nearly 10 miles throughout Old Tampa Bay. This drive seems like you're floating in between sky and water, with the bay expanding on both sides and just the occasional island damaging the marine expanse. October brings specifically clear presence, frequently allowing sights that extend 20 miles or even more throughout the water.



The western section of the embankment, as you approach Clearwater, supplies one of the most remarkable landscapes. The bay widens here, and on clear October mid-days, you can see the high-rises of Clearwater Beach glinting in the distance versus the much deeper blue of the Gulf beyond. The causeway rests reduced enough to the water that you feel totally linked to the bay, with watercrafts passing below the bridges and birds wheeling expenses.



Traffic relocations continuously yet not rushed, giving you time to absorb the panoramic water sights without feeling pressured. The shoulder consists of large bike lanes and periodic pull-offs where you can stop to fully appreciate the landscapes. October weekdays offer the most effective experience, with lighter traffic than weekend break drives but the same incredible sights.



Pinellas Bayway: Gateway to Paradise



The Pinellas Bayway system attaches St. Petersburg to the obstacle islands with a series of bridges and embankments that use some of the most remarkable water crossings in the Tampa Bay location. The toll bridges arc high over the Intracoastal Waterway, offering raised sights that let you see for miles in every direction. October's clear skies indicate these bridges use unmatched exposure of the surrounding waters and islands.



The drive throughout these bridges gives you a real feeling of Tampa Bay's location. Looking north, you can see the Sunshine Skyway Bridge covering the major shipping network. To the south, the obstacle islands stretch in a sandy chain, securing the bay from the Gulf. The bridge comes close to wind with preserved mangrove islands, where October brings energetic wildlife as birds move with the area and fish become much more energetic in the cooling waters.



Ft De Soto Park sits at the southern end of the Pinellas Bayway, where you can extend your coastal drive via the park's beautiful loop roadway. The park roadways wind through coastal hammocks and along pristine beaches, with October providing comfortable temperature levels best for incorporating your drive with some coastline time or a walk along the historic fort's walls.

The Gandy Bridge Alternative



While the Howard Frankland and Courtney Campbell embankments obtain even more interest, the Gandy Bridge offers a quieter option for going across Tampa Bay. This older course attaches Tampa straight to St. Petersburg, running southern of the various other crossings and offering a different point of view on the bay. The eastern strategy from Tampa goes through suburbs before opening up to the water going across.



The bridge itself sits relatively reduced to the water, developing an intimate link with the bay. October brings especially energetic angling task around the bridge pilings, with anglers casting from boats positioned to make use of the structure's fish-attracting residential properties. The western technique into St. Petersburg contours via Weedon Island Preserve, where mangrove forests produce an all-natural passage result prior to opening to the established coastline.



Expanding Your Drive: The Sunshine Skyway



No conversation of Tampa Bay seaside drives would certainly be full without discussing the Sunshine Skyway Bridge, although it technically extends beyond the immediate Tampa location. This building wonder soars 430 feet above the shipping network, attaching St. Petersburg to the southerly reaches of Tampa Bay. The October drive throughout this bridge uses unparalleled sights everywhere.



The approach ramps gradually climb, building expectancy as the main span appears. When on the bridge deck, you're put on hold high over the bay with only cable television stays and skies bordering you. On clear October days, you can see from Tampa in the north to Sarasota in the south, with the Gulf stretching constantly to the west. Weather Considerations and Practical Tips



While October uses Tampa's the majority of reputable weather, it's still Florida, and conditions can stun you. Early October sometimes keeps summertime's pattern of afternoon clouds, though these rarely become the torrential storms common in earlier months. Late October occasionally sees the first tips of winter's strategy, with cooler mornings and reduced humidity degrees.



The coastal roadways deal with in a different way than inland routes. Sea breezes can be solid, particularly on the high bridges, so preserve recognition even in tranquil conditions. Salt spray is much less typical in October's drier air, yet it still pays to wash your vehicle after expanded coastal drives to stop deterioration.



Weekday drives normally provide the smoothest website traffic flow, while weekend breaks bring more leisure vehicle drivers and beachgoers. Early October still sees some summertime trip laggers, however by mid-month, web traffic patterns settle into the comfortable rhythm that makes autumn driving so pleasant. The snowbird movement commonly starts in earnest around Thanksgiving, so October stands for a pleasant place between summer visitors and wintertime citizens.
